Fire Incident at Rotterdam Science Tower – Kadans Reaffirms Commitment to Safety and Tenant Support
17 September 2025 – On Wednesday, 16 September, another fire incident occurred at the Rotterdam Science Tower, this time in a storage area within the building. Authorities suspect possible arson and have launched an official investigation.
Kadans Science Partner is deeply affected by these repeated incidents and places the safety and wellbeing of its tenants as an absolute priority. We are relieved to report that no injuries occurred during the recent events. Thanks to well-functioning technical systems and the swift response of tenants and staff in following evacuation procedures, the building was cleared in a safe and orderly manner. Emergency services were promptly alerted and acted with professionalism.
In response to the incident, additional safety measures have been implemented immediately, including enhanced camera surveillance, increased monitoring, and extra security patrols. Kadans remains closely involved in the situation, working in coordination with police, fire services, and other relevant authorities, while maintaining open communication with tenants regarding progress and actions taken.
At this time, every effort is being made to fully restore safety within the building. Current tenants have been informed accordingly. Once all repairs and safety checks are completed, the building will be reopened and fully operational.
